Abstract
We propose a hybrid data scheduling algorithm for mobile data broadcasting with reverse channels. A broadcast server collects statistics of requests from clients. At the update time of request statistics, the server partitions the data items into hot and cold sets, according to the number of requests. The broadcast server schedules and broadcasts hot items each of which has a different interval. On an empty slot without a hot item, the server broadcasts a cold item in an on-demand manner. Simulations show that our proposed algorithm allows the server to reach high successful response ratio with practically small response time.
